Dating Confidence Reset

Start by deciding what you want from dating right now: casual conversation, a few dates, or something more serious. Naming your intent makes choices easier—who to message, how quickly to respond, and when to suggest meeting. Keep that intent visible as you browse and talk so small decisions align with your bigger goal.

Set realistic expectations. Online dating is a mixed bag: some chats go nowhere, others lead to something real. Expect a range of outcomes instead of one fixed result. That mindset protects your energy and helps you celebrate small wins—good conversations, clear boundaries, or learning what you don’t want.

Pace conversations with purpose. Move at a tempo that feels comfortable: ask one or two thoughtful questions each exchange, share a clear but brief detail about yourself, and let replies come in without pressure. If someone rushes, ghosting, or pushes you past your comfort zone, that is useful data about fit.

Choose matches more thoughtfully. Scan profiles for signals that match your intent—shared interests, similar communication style, or clear mentions of relationship goals. Use filters and your gut: it’s fine to prioritize quality over quantity and message fewer people more intentionally.

Measure progress in small steps. Track outcomes that matter to you: number of meaningful conversations, dates scheduled, or times you set a boundary and it was respected. These are healthier metrics than message counts or response rates.

Protect your emotional steadiness. Take breaks, limit app time, and do things that restore you between sessions. If a rejection or slow reply hits hard, pause, breathe, and remind yourself that one interaction doesn’t define your worth.
